Choosing the right size dumpster is crucial for efficiency and cost effectiveness. Selecting a dumpster that is either too large or too small can lead to unnecessary expenses and logistical issues. To determine the appropriate size, consider the scope and scale of your project carefully. Understanding your waste type and quantity will guide you in choosing a dumpster that accommodates your disposal needs. Common sizes include 10, 20, 30, and 40 yard options, each designed for varying project demands. A thorough assessment of your waste production habits will help ensure that you do not pay more than needed for a larger dumpster.

Gaining insights into pricing structures is essential for budgeting effectively. Prices typically vary based on dumpster size, rental duration, and regional factors. Companies may offer flat rates or variable pricing based on weight and time usage. Securing detailed quotes will help you understand which pricing model suits your budget better. Additionally, different providers might have distinct approaches to pricing, and comparing quotes can ensure competitive costs. Ensure you clarify whether prices include pickup and disposal fees to avoid later surprises.
A comprehensive guide to avoiding unexpected expenses starts with understanding terms and conditions related to extra fees. Dumpster rentals might incur hidden fees for issues such as exceeding weight limits or extending rental duration without notice. Request full transparency regarding all potential charges upfront. This includes environmental fees, late return penalties, and other ostensibly minor but cumulative costs. Meticulously reviewing contracts and asking specific questions about possible additional charges can protect you from financial pitfalls. To avoid sticker shock, ensure you're fully informed about what each fee entails.
